Discovering Japanese Food: Beauty in Simplicity and Precision:
Japanese gastronomy is appreciated for being simple, precise, and above all, utilizing high-quality food ingredients. In most Japanese dishes, a smaller portion is more effective than larger portions covered with heavy sauces designed to disguise flavors. Sushi, sashimi and tempura are amongst the most coveted Japanese dishes yet, these are only a portion of the entire culinary repertoire.
There are also vegetarian options in the Japanese diet such as vegetable tempura, tofu and seaweed salad which are quite popular. And one of the most rewarding food experiences is when one is offered a kaiseki, a multi-course traditional Japanese dinner that highlights seasonal ingredients and is as much an art as it is a meal. Japanese cuisine is not only meant to satisfy one’s appetite but also please one’s eyes as every platter is prepared and served with great care.

Middle Eastern Food: The Mixing of Cultures is Definitely in Their Tummies:
The Middle Eastern food is quite simply stunning where one can see rich designs with a wide variety of tastes, aromas, and textures; characters, images of people of nations in the built up of this region. This cuisine is characterized by fresh wholesome ingredients in the form of grains, legumes, vegetables, and spices. Middle Eastern food is all about abundance and satisfaction equally delicious and nutritious.
Some western cuisines that are improved and redesigned to make some of the best Middle Eastern food include vegetarian delicacies such as hummus, falafel and tabbouleh. They are not only tasty but also healthy making the dishes a favorite for many people looking for healthy options. Middle Eastern food is also characterized by Spices like cumin, coriander and sumac that are abundant and hencebound themselves to every food. From small plates of mezze to the high calorie smoke flavored Shawarma, there is so much more to Middle Eastern food than meets the eye’s vision.
